PULSEJACK™ LAN/ Filtered Connectors
Ethernet, PoE (Power over Ethernet), Gigabit, USB Options
Pulse offers a broad selection of filtered connectors. Each Pulsejack
platform is designed to house a range of magnetic configurations and other
internal components (common mode termination) with four 75ohm
resistors and HV Cap, chip-side pin outs, shield options, USB ports and
LED options. Features: • Meets or exceeds IEEE 802.3 and ANSI
X3.263 • 1500 Vrms isolation • Self-contained termination saves PCB
space • Patented InterLock Base construction for high reliability

KEY (1) Tab Down = thumb lock facing down to PCB; Tab
Up = thumb lock facing away from PCB
(2) Magnetics = Chip (PHY) to Cable (Media) side: T=
Transformer, C = Common Mode Choke, S = Shunt
Inductor
(3) Turns Ratio = Chip (PHY) to Cable (Media) side
(4) CMT (Common Mode Termination) with HV Cap within
the connector; no extra PCB real estate required
(5) EMI Tabs = On the outside face of the shield for
connecting to a front panel
(6) LEDs require external 5V source and 250Ω external
resistors ("R") = 250Ω internal resistor built-in
(7) Note: For example, 1X4 = 1 row/4 columns or a 2X4 = 2
rows/4 columns
(8) LEDs: L-R = Left - Right : G = green, Y = yellow;
“—” = none; Bicolor : G/O = Green/Orange, Y/G =
Yellow/Green, G/Y = Green/Yellow
(9) Includes ESD overvoltage protection diodes
(10) Provides typically 2kV voltage isolation and are
compliant to IEEE 802.3af PoE standard
(11) Includes Gigabit compatible magnetics
(12) Built-In BST Circuit = Capacitor resistor termination
circuit
(13) Different electrical connection (See datasheet for more
information)
(14) PoE = Power over Ethernet compatible product,
compliant to IEEE 802.3af standard, providing
minimum 1.5kV isolation
(15) Number of PCB connections required for RJ-45
connector communication to PHY/IC Chip
(16) Total number of PCB pins for PCB layout, which
include LED option

DSL (CPE) Filters
These customer premises equipment (CPE) filters are designed to expedite the service delivery and
improve the performance of digital subscriber line (DSL) and home phoneline network services over plain
old telephone service (POTS). Its filter design electronically isolates the high-speed DSL and HPN data
streams from the voice-band POTS to provide premium quality and optimal DSL and HPN data rates.
Z-230PJ Economical Single-Line DSL Filter
• Filters one or more phone devices sharing a single jack
• Compact in-line design - plugs into any standard phone jack
• Blocks and isolates DSL/HPN from phone equipment
• Supports G. lite, G.dmt ADSL, V.90, Caller ID and metallic-loop
testing
• Compliant and listed with FCC, UL, CE, CSA and T1E1
Dual-Line DSL Filter
• Filters one or more phone devices sharing a
single jack on line 1 and line 2
• Provides separate jacks for phone and DSL/HPN
• Blocks and isolates DSL/HPN from phone
equipment
• Supports G. lite, G. dmt, ADSL, V.90, Caller ID
and metallic-loop testing
• Compliant and listed with FCC, CS03, UL, CE and
CSA
• Compact in-line design - plugs into any standard
phone jack
• Wall-mount design-snaps over existing wall
outlet
